    Infractions received on old posts

    I personally don't think it's fair to receive an infraction for an old post that was written a long time ago. There should be an amount of time from creation that a post can receive an infraction for, my suggestion is one month.

    If someone really hated you then they could look up all your old posts and find a couple that could receive infractions and bam, they report you and your temp banned.

    Thoughts on this?
